Patent number: 10167117Abstract: A lid is provided for covering or sealing a cup by engaging a rim flange of the cup. The lid includes a top portion and an annular side plate which extends downwardly from periphery of the top portion. The plate is formed with a hole. An engagement plate is disposed on the side plate. A bottom edge of the engagement plate is connected to the plate. A top edge of the engagement plate stretches upwardly along the hole, so that the engagement plate is located in the hole. The plates are flexible. As such, the engagement plate can be pressed and bent inwardly when the lid covers a cup. The engagement plate would then engage with the rim flange of the cup so as to enhance engagement of the lid and the cup.Type: GrantFiled: January 29, 2016Date of Patent: January 1, 2019Assignee: RICH CUP BIO-CHEMICAL TECHNOLOGY CO., LTD.Inventor: Ching-Wen Chang

Patent number: 9387642Abstract: A process for manufacturing a heat insulation container mainly includes preparing a coating material by mixing a binder and a thermo-expandable powder, coating such coating material on a surface of a container and then heating the container to foam the coated material after the container is shaped. The foamed coating material is therefore provides the container with heat insulation property. The thermo-expandable powder consists of a plurality of thermo-expandable microcapsules, each of which consists of a thermoplastic polymer shell and a solvent wrapped by the thermoplastic polymer shell. To obtain a smooth surface, the soften point of the binder is required to be lower than the boiling point of the solvent.Type: GrantFiled: April 28, 2015Date of Patent: July 12, 2016Assignee: RICH CUP BIO-CHEMICAL TECHNOLOGY CO., LTD.Inventors: Sheng-Shu Chang, Hung-Ying Su

Patent number: 8585946Abstract: A method for making heat-insulated paper containers and the products made by the same. The method includes steps of: (a) mixing and blending polyethylene terephthalate or polypropylene with an adhesive to form a polymer material; (b) heating and extruding the polymer material with an extruder machine to form a film and coating a surface of paper with the film; (c) cooling and laminating the paper with a laminating roller; (d) continuously coating another surface of the paper with a foam material; and then furling the paper after drying; and cutting the paper into a semi-product and then molding into a paper container; (e) heating the foam material with a heating device. The method can enhance the foam uniformity and the production rate, and decrease the defective rate.Type: GrantFiled: October 23, 2008Date of Patent: November 19, 2013Assignee: Rich Cup Bio-Chemical Technology Co., Ltd.Inventor: Ching-Wen Chang

Publication number: 20130193199Abstract: A container includes a paper-made container body, a waterproofing layer and a foaming layer. The container body has an outer surface and an inner surface. The waterproofing layer is coated on the inner surface in the manner of lamintaing. The waterproofing layer mainly consists of talcum powder, resin and calcium carbonate. The foaming layer is disposed on at least a part of the outer surface. The foaming layer consists of a binder and a thermo-expandable powder. The binder is selected from a group consisting of polyvinyl acetate resin, ethylene vinyl acetate resin, polyacrylic acid resin and a mixture thereof. The thermo-expandable powder consists of a plurality of thermo-expandable microcapsules, each of which consists of a thermoplastic polymer shell and a low-boiling-point solvent wrapped by the thermoplastic polymer shell.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 13, 2013Publication date: August 1, 2013Applicant: RICH CUP BIO-CHEMICAL TECHNOLOGY CO., LTD.Inventor: Rich Cup Bio-Chemical Technology Co., Ltd.

Publication number: 20130149449Abstract: The method of forming a pigment layer and a foam layer on a substrate includes steps of material preparation, material coating, pigment coating and foaming. A coating material layer is coated on the substrate, and then a pigment layer is coated on the substrate before the coating material layer is foamed. Thus the pigment can be coated on the substrate more quickly, easily and more accurately.Type: ApplicationFiled: February 5, 2013Publication date: June 13, 2013Applicant: RICH CUP BIO-CHEMICAL TECHNOLOGY CO., LTD.Inventor: RICH CUP BIO-CHEMICAL TECHNOLOGY CO., LTD.

Publication number: 20110247749Abstract: A process for coating a foamed coating material on a container or the like mainly includes preparing a coating material by heat blending or kneading a solid thermoplastic binder with a solid thermo-expandable powder consisting of a plurality of solid thermo-expandable microcapsules till the solid thermoplastic binder being gelatinized so that the thermo-expandable microcapsules being uniformly spread in the gelatinized thermoplastic binder, coating such coating material on a surface of a container and then heating the container to foam the coated material. The foamed coating material is therefore provides the container with heat insulation property.Type: ApplicationFiled: May 18, 2010Publication date: October 13, 2011Applicant: RICH CUP BIO-CHEMICAL TECHNOLOGY CO., LTD.Inventors: CHING-WEN CHANG, HUNG-YING SU
